Status in mutter package in Ubuntu: New Bug description: When a window is partially behind another and I click on the title bar, the window I clicked on does not come forward to get focus. I have to click in the body of the window for this to happen. This only started happening when I upgraded to Ubuntu Budgie 23.04. I am running Ubuntu Budgie 23.04, Budgie desktop version 10.7.1 Running an Nvidia GP108 [GeForce GT 1030] using the nvidia-driver-525.
